How many families applied

Preferences expressed and offers made at Year 7, as published by the Department for Education. These describe demand. They do not indicate whether any particular child would be offered a place.

In the 2025 intake, 69 families named Bradford Girls' Grammar School as their first preference, and the school made 125 offers.

That is 0.55 first preferences per place offered, which places it above 7% of schools admitting at Year 7 in England that year.

More first preferences per place than 7% of comparable schools position among schools in England admitting at Year 7, 2025 intake

Fewer families are naming it first. Across the 5 most recent years held, first preferences per place averaged 1.0 in 2021–2022 and 0.58 in 2024–2025.

Progress 8 compares pupils here with pupils nationally who had similar results at the end of primary school; 0 is average. It is an estimate, and DfE publishes a range it is likely to fall within. Where that range spans zero, the school cannot be said to be above or below average.

These come from the School Workforce Census, which follows each teacher into the next year. The numbers count full-time jobs, so a teacher who works half the week counts as half. They are not a count of people.
